3D Printing in Oral Surgery



To enhance the field of dental surgery, you can explore the subtopic of 3D printing in oral surgery. This innovative technology has the possible to revolutionize the way oral doctors run and deal with people. Right here are four vital methods which 3D printing is forming the field:

- ** Personalized Surgical Guides **: 3D printing allows for the development of highly exact and patient-specific medical overviews, boosting the precision and efficiency of procedures.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, minimizing the demand for conventional grafting strategies and boosting healing and healing time.

- ** Education and Training **: 3D printing can be utilized to develop realistic surgical designs for instructional objectives, enabling oral cosmetic surgeons to exercise intricate procedures prior to executing them on individuals.

With its possible to improve precision, personalization, and training, 3D printing is an exciting development in the field of dental surgery.

Minimally Invasive Techniques



To better advance the field of oral surgery, accept the capacity of minimally invasive methods that can greatly profit both specialists and patients alike.

Minimally intrusive techniques are changing the field by minimizing medical trauma, lessening post-operative discomfort, and speeding up the recuperation process. These techniques include using smaller incisions and specialized tools to perform procedures with precision and efficiency.

By utilizing advanced imaging technology, such as cone beam of light calculated tomography (CBCT), doctors can precisely prepare and perform surgical procedures with marginal invasiveness.

Additionally, using lasers in dental surgery permits specific cells cutting and coagulation, resulting in lessened blood loss and minimized healing time.
